  On July 07 2009 19:48 street_hooker wrote:
how does a stoploss matter. It doesnt matter when you play its the same EV. Not like you're going to run better in the next 10 hours.




It matters because when people are losing they take more risks in order to try and "win it back" or "get back to even" as they say. Often sacrificing +EV and increasing variance greatly. A player who when in the right mindset might say a shove is very thin in a particular spot may very well change that opinion to this is an auto-shove spot or convince themselves to do so more often.

Spitfiree   Bulgaria. Jul 08 2009 07:15. Posts 9634

Fayth is definitely right
i doubt there is anyone in the world who can 24 table and be on his A game
maybe Elky is the only guy that can do it but somehow i still doubt he s playing his best

cant u just think of some rules for urself ?
smtng like this for example :
- 10 buy in stop loss
- quit tables every time u feel u r not playing well
- quit tables every time u feel u r about to tilt
- dont play a session longer than lets say 2 hours , altho 2-3 hours is optimal for me but im 6 tabling so im not put under a lot of pressure , but thats me so u should try and see whats best for you
- drop down to 6-9 tables or smtng srsly.
